Description jogi 2006-03-27 08:24:35 UTC
- Load corrupted file (as attached)
- Click on "no" on Repairing question dialog
BUG: Again a dialog informs that the file can not be opened but the user has
already made the choice not to open it. Then the filter selection box comes up
which also is not needed anymore in that scenario.

Metric: In SO7 PP5 you need one click to dismiss the operation. in SO 8
SRC680m159 you need two clicks more on two additional dialogs.

Comment 2 mikhail.voytenko 2006-03-27 09:38:09 UTC
As we have discussed with JSI the second notification is acceptable, but the
filter selection dialog is the bug in this scenario. The first dialog asks
whether the corrupted document should be recovered and when the user selects
"No" the second dialog notifies that the document could not be opened because no
recovery could be done.
